What the 2025 report finds

Across the interviews, vendors are converging on agentic AI as the next operational layer for networks, moving past predictive and generative waves toward multi-agent systems that require standardization and vendor-neutral interoperability to reach autonomous operations.

  1. Three waves of AI, now cresting on agentic

    Sponsors frame a progression from predictive ML to generative AI to agentic AI. Ericsson, Blue Planet, Ribbon, and IBM all describe layered architectures and multi-phase journeys moving operations toward autonomy.

  2. Autonomy needs divide-and-conquer, not one giant model

    Nokia targets level-four autonomy by breaking complex network domains into specialized expert systems. Blue Planet similarly structures AI Studio across agentic core, tooling, and application layers rather than a monolithic approach.

  3. Multi-vendor interoperability is the gating problem

    Standardization recurs as the blocker to autonomous operations. Nokia points to protocols like MCP, Cisco's open-source AGNTCY project aims for an "internet of agents" spanning vendors, and Ribbon commits to a vendor-neutral strategy.

  4. AI is pitched at concrete operational outcomes

    Use cases are specific: IBM claims 90-95% cloud-like utilization and pre-outage remediation, Arista analyzed AI application impact on enterprise WANs, and Blue Planet instantiates dynamic network slices via natural language.

  5. The skills gap is an explicit driver

    Vendors position AI as a response to operational complexity and staffing shortages. Nokia's three-pronged strategy pairs accessible interfaces, consultative services, and SaaS, while Ericsson cites 84% of leaders calling AI critical within three years.

Cisco Systems

Agency Project: Building the Internet of Agents for Enterprise AI Collaboration

  • Cisco's AGNTCY is an open-source initiative building an "internet of agents" for cross-vendor AI collaboration.
  • The framework spans four capabilities: discovery, composition, secure communication, and performance evaluation.
  • AGNTCY is backed by major technology companies, signaling an industry-wide interoperability push.
Abstract
Vijoy Pandey, SVP & GM, Outshift by Cisco at Cisco Systems, discusses the AGNTCY project, an open-source initiative backed by major technology companies that aims to build an "internet of agents" enabling autonomous AI agents to collaborate across different vendor environments. He explains that AGNTCY provides an architectural framework with four key capabilities - discovery, composition, secure communication, and performance evaluation.

IBM

What's Next for AI-Driven Networking

  • IBM Network Intelligence targets cloud-like network utilization rates of 90-95%.
  • The product aims to identify and remediate issues before outages occur, optimizing capex.
  • It pairs analytical AI for telemetry scale with generative AI to cut across siloed data and systems.
Abstract
Ben Hickey from IBM introduces IBM Network Intelligence, a new product designed to enable autonomous network operations that can identify and remediate issues before outages occur while optimizing capital expenditure and achieving cloud-like utilization rates of 90-95%. The solution combines analytical AI for handling network telemetry scale with generative AI capabilities to cut across siloed data and systems.
